Meat Loaf trying to push Prince Andrew into a moat has gone viral following the rock star’s death.The US singer and actor (real name Marvin Lee Aday) passed away last night (January 20), according to a statement posted on his official Facebook page this morning (January 21).

A cause of death is not yet known.Since the news broke, fans and figures from the world of entertainment have taken to social media to pay tribute and share stories from Meat Loaf’s career.One story in particular that has garnered a lot of attention is the time he threatened to push Prince Andrew in a moat when he appeared as a contestant on It’s A Royal Knockout in 1987.The show was a one-off charity event staged on the lakeside lawn of Alton Towers.

It featured four teams of celebrities, each captained by a member of the Royal Family, battling it out in a series of games.

In one round, for example, the players dressed up as giant vegetables and threw fake hams at each other.Meat Loaf was on the Duchess of York’s team, and it seemed that Sarah Ferguson was at the centre of tension between the singer and her ex-husband Prince Andrew.In a 2003 interview with The Guardian, Meat Loaf talked about being in the competition. “It was great fun.
